[DRIVERS] Marvell/Aquantia Ethernet
Hi everyone,
- Marvell/Aquantia Ethernet Drivers (Drivers Only) :
Drivers : 2.2.1.0 WHQL [15/09/2020]
Download : Link
Install/Update Process :
Right click on "aqnic650.inf" > Install > Wait for the message "The operation completed successfully" or for restart request
OS requirements : Windows 10 64 bit 1903/19H1/18362.x or more recent.
Hardware requirements : Marvell/Aquantia Ethernet controller.
TIPS :
If you want to manage the drivers (remove old/unused drivers for example) that you have in your Windows DriverStore
Use Driver Store Explorer (Right click on "Rapr.exe" > Run as administrator).
If you want better interrupts delivery latency
Enable MSI (Message Signaled-based Interrupts) mode on all your supported devices (see the column "supported modes") with
MSI Mode Utility (Right click on "MSI_util_v3.exe" > Run as administrator).Last edited by MoKiChU; 01-01-2021 at 01:02 PM.
